CBS News Revamps Evening News Program

CBS News is revamping its evening news program, planning to launch a '60 Minutes'-style show featuring four veteran journalists in a bid to boost ratings, after Norah O'Donnell steps down as anchor. The show will have a new format, move back to CBS' Broadcast Center in Hell's Kitchen, and be supervised by '60 Minutes' executive producer Bill Owens.

Norah O'Donnell leaving CBS Evening News

Norah O’Donnell is leaving her role as anchor and managing editor of the CBS Evening News after five years. The network has not named a replacement yet.
